2. Josh Rosenthal
In 2013 Josh Rosenthal was sentenced to 37 months in prison for his role in a large marijuana growing operation. That’s way worse than what the NSAC did to Nick Diaz.
The prison sentence stemmed from an April 2012 raid of a warehouse that was owned by the famed MMA referee. Inside the warehouse was an estimated $6 million worth of marijuana plants. Rosenthal could have received as much as 10 years in prison.
After his arrest but before he began serving his sentence Rosenthal continued to referee fights and simply declined comment anytime someone asked him about the charges.
He was released in March of 2015, 18 months earlier than expected.
